10/ A new study published in September 2025 found that
"Many regions, including major reservoirs, may face high risk of Day Zero Drought by the 2020s and 2030s. Despite model & scenario uncertainties, consistent DZD hotspots emerge across the Mediterranean, S. Africa, & parts of N. America"

"We suggest that SO convection should be considered as a tipping element in the Earth system, with the bipolar convection seesaw forming a previously unidentified potential cross-hemispheric link between different tipping elements"
www.nature.com/articles/s41...
www.nature.com/articles/s41...
Earth system response to Heinrich events explained by a bipolar convection seesaw - Nature Geoscience
The onset of Southern Ocean convection following a slowing of the Atlantic Meridional Overturning Circulation during Heinrich events can help explain rapid CO2 increases and Antarctic warming during t...

According to Mohammad-Ali Moallem, the manager of the Karaj Dam, rainfall has plummeted dramatically.
"We had a 92% decrease in rain compared to last year," he said. "We have only eight per cent water in our reservoir — and most of it is unusable and considered 'dead water.'"
